Bronte Park is midway between Hobart and Queenstown, close to the geographic centre of Tasmania. Once a construction town for the Nive River hydro-electric scheme, it is now a holiday village set amongst rolling mountains, with crystal clear waterways and an abundance of wildlife. Its location in the midst of excellent trout fishing lakes makes it a perfect base for fishermen, kayakers and bushwalkers. The original Hydro Electric Commission huts have been recycled as the Bronte Park Highland Village with chalets, a hostel and store and a licensed picnic ground.

Geographic Location

147km NW of Hobart  115km E of Queenstown
